I get what you're saying and it sounds like a good idea but wouldn't a standard brake bolt bend cause there's gonna be a lot of stress on it if u accidentally land on the brake!
 

yamum99

Member
yeah, i dont know if there is suck thing as a chromoly brake bolt, but if there is certainly something stronger i would recomend using that.
 
get a high tensile 6mm bolt. its the closest thing to a brake bolt and 10 times stronger. you just have to make the hole in your deck and brake a little bit bigger with a 6mm or 1/4" drill bit. once you've done that the bolt should fit.
